Although children are normally transparent about what they want or need, do not be fooled into thinking that this is the case all the time. Deep inside, they do have some hidden needs that need to be addressed as well, although they may not voice them out. We as parents have to understand them completely to gain access to these hidden needs, or feeling that they have, in order to have a fruitful and beautiful relationship with our children. Children would want their hidden needs to be addressed as well, although they may not say so. If the needs are not addressed, they would display their displeasure by throwing tantrums, or cry for small issues. We as parents, are responsible in making sure that the feelings and wants of our children are fully understood and fulfilled, so what can we do to deal with this?
Firstly, parents must understand that children constantly need attention, and if they do not get enough of it, they would become quite different and reserved, resulting in several uncomfortable situations. Thus as a parent, the most powerful balm that you could provide your child with is your attention. Your child must be your number one priority, and make sure that you show that to your child as well. Put away other things such as work, television and friends when you are at home, and concentrate fully on your child. This would make your child feel fully-wanted, and never again would you hear complaints that you are neglecting your child.
Attention is a powerful tool to create a special bond between the parent and the child, thus make full use of it to create a beautiful relationship for you and your child. Set up a good long-range policy with your child that you utilize consistently with all your children (if you have more than one). Offer plenty of love with your attention, and always be gentle with your children. Make your children understand what is right or wrong, and why they are such. Listen to your children, and let them share what they feel. On your part, make them feel wanted, and give them all the attention that they seek. Make them understand that there is a time for everything, and everyone would get a chance to do what he or she wants at a certain time.
Always remember that a parent’s attention is the most powerful and effective remedy for a lot of issues and problems that a child might be facing, thus always be there for your child, and look forward towards a beautiful long term relationship with your kid.
